Non-Marking Split Bar Tread — Is It Right for Your Work?
| Pattern | Best Used For |
|---|---|
| Bar | Flat terrain · large ground contact · stability on firm surfaces |
| Block | General purpose · hardpack · dirt · long pavement runs |
| C-Lug | Mixed terrain · grading · site work · on/off road · concrete & dirt |
| Split Bar | Bidirectional traction · shock absorption · smooth ride on varied ground |
| Turf | Lawns · landscaping · minimal ground disturbance |
| Z-Lug | Steep grades · snow · ice · maximum traction applications |

The Non-Marking Split Bar combines the bidirectional traction and smooth ride of the Split Bar pattern with a white rubber compound that won't mark finished surfaces. Perfect for indoor construction, renovations on existing floors, and warehouse environments where both traction and surface protection matter. See all available patterns at the bottom of this page.
Know Your Machine: Bobcat T250 Undercarriage Facts
The T250 is a large-frame Bobcat CTL delivering 81 hp and 2,500 lbs rated operating capacity on a single standard track width of 450mm (17.7"). At 9,347 lbs with 5.6 psi ground pressure, it's built for serious earthmoving, loading, and site development. What's Inside the Track
| Component | Specification | Why It Matters |
|---|---|---|
| Iron Cores | Drop-forged steel embeds · pitch-spaced | Maintain track shape · resist deformation under load · engage sprocket cleanly |
| Steel Cords | Acid-washed · continuous cord layer | Carry tensile load · prevent stretching · hold pitch dimension over time |
| Rubber Compound | Non-marking white rubber · premium compound | Won't leave black marks on finished surfaces · same durability as standard |
| Non-Marking Split Bar Tread | White rubber compound, no black marks | Split bar pattern for bidirectional traction. Premium compound for sensitive surfaces. |
| Lug Height | ~1" nominal new depth | Replace when worn below ⅓ remaining — traction loss accelerates past that point |
Is It Time to Replace Your T250's Tracks?
| What You're Seeing | What It Means | Action |
|---|---|---|
| Exposed steel cords | Carcass worn through — moisture will corrode cords | Replace immediately |
| Flat or missing lugs | Tread depth below ⅓ of original 1" — traction loss | Plan replacement soon |
| Track won't hold tension | Carcass has stretched beyond adjuster range | Replace track · inspect adjuster |
| Cracks around guide bars | Aging rubber · UV damage · abrasive turning | Monitor closely, plan replacement |
| Track jumping off | Tension too loose OR guide bar/idler damage | Check tension first · inspect guide bars |
At 9,347 lbs operating weight the T250 accelerates track wear faster than lighter machines. On abrasive surfaces (concrete, asphalt), expect 1,200–1,500 hours from quality replacement tracks. Soft-ground or dirt-only work can extend this considerably.
